Character by F. Bordewijk

A Novel of Father and Son

The novel is a compelling exploration of the complex relationship between a young man and his estranged father set in early 20th-century Rotterdam. The protagonist, a determined and ambitious lawyer, struggles to overcome the oppressive influence of his father, a ruthless and domineering bailiff. As he navigates the challenges of his personal and professional life, the story delves into themes of ambition, resilience, and the intricate dynamics of familial bonds, ultimately highlighting the protagonist's quest for independence and self-identity amidst adversity.
